Creating the Endpoints

Each server instance in the database mirroring configuration must have an endpoint defined so that the other servers can communicate with it. This is sort of like a private phone line to your friends. Let’s use the scripts provided as opposed to using the Configure Security Wizard. The first endpoint script is in the file 2008 Create EndPoint Partner1.SQL.

From SSMS, you need to open a new query connection to your principal database by selecting File, New and in the New Query dialog, selecting Query with Current Connection. Open the SQL file for the first endpoint.
